FreeBSD Linux: Remove Clear GPT Partition Table from drives
Problem: FreeBSD 9 use GPT Partitionlabel by default to remove with Linux do: fdisk message: WARNING: GTP (GUID Partition Table) detected on '/dev/sdX' The util fdisk isn't support GPT. do on console: sudo parted /dev/sdX mklabel msdos (Enter Yes!) quit now use Linux fdisk to recreate a new partion Table
FreeBSD 8.0: Perl Webmin Bug
System FreeBSD 8.0 R3 AMD64 Webmin 1.510 Perl 5.8.9 Webmin-Log: symbol „sdbm_open“ – do portupgrade -f webmin – do portupgrade -f perl – do perl-after-upgrade -f (to update all deps of Perl)
